Max Gautier
3 months ago
committed by
GitHub
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
4 changed files with
17 additions and
3 deletions
-
.gitlab-ci/kubevirt.yml
-
docs/developers/ci.md
-
tests/files/fedora40-flannel-crio-collection-scale.yml
-
tests/scripts/testcases_run.sh
|
|
@ -40,7 +40,6 @@ pr: |
|
|
|
- debian11-macvlan |
|
|
|
- debian12-cilium |
|
|
|
- fedora39-kube-router |
|
|
|
# FIXME: this test if broken (perma-failing) |
|
|
|
- openeuler24-calico |
|
|
|
- rockylinux9-cilium |
|
|
|
- ubuntu22-calico-all-in-one |
|
|
@ -53,6 +52,7 @@ pr: |
|
|
|
- ubuntu24-kube-router-svc-proxy |
|
|
|
- ubuntu24-ha-separate-etcd |
|
|
|
- flatcar4081-calico |
|
|
|
- fedora40-flannel-crio-collection-scale |
|
|
|
|
|
|
|
# The ubuntu24-calico-all-in-one jobs are meant as early stages to prevent running the full CI if something is horribly broken |
|
|
|
ubuntu24-calico-all-in-one: |
|
|
|
|
|
@ -28,7 +28,7 @@ amazon |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
debian11 |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
debian12 |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
fedora39 | :white_check_mark: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
fedora40 |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
fedora40 | :white_check_mark: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
flatcar4081 |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
openeuler24 |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
rockylinux9 | :x: | :x: | :x: | :x: | :x: | :x: | :x: | |
|
|
|
|
|
@ -0,0 +1,9 @@ |
|
|
|
--- |
|
|
|
cloud_image: fedora-40 |
|
|
|
network_plugin: flannel |
|
|
|
container_manager: crio |
|
|
|
|
|
|
|
cluster_layout: |
|
|
|
- node_groups: ['kube_control_plane', 'etcd'] |
|
|
|
- node_groups: ['kube_node'] |
|
|
|
- node_groups: ['kube_node', 'for_scale'] |
|
|
@ -52,7 +52,12 @@ ansible-playbook \ |
|
|
|
## START KUBESPRAY |
|
|
|
|
|
|
|
# Create cluster |
|
|
|
run_playbook cluster |
|
|
|
if [[ "${TESTCASE}" =~ "scale" ]]; then |
|
|
|
run_playbook cluster --limit '!for_scale' |
|
|
|
run_playbook scale --limit 'for_scale' |
|
|
|
else |
|
|
|
run_playbook cluster |
|
|
|
fi |
|
|
|
|
|
|
|
# Repeat deployment if testing upgrade |
|
|
|
if [ "${UPGRADE_TEST}" != "false" ]; then |
|
|
|